There are also important design considerations around rigid flex pcb design guidelines and hdi pcb board supplier option. If a board has flex sections, the designer should represent bend span, layer changes, copper balance, and coverlay selection. If a board is densely transmitted, the stackup has to support fine lines, microvia reliability, and thermal performance. High reliability flexible circuits and custom etched flex circuits are particularly pertinent in items that must endure vibration, duplicated activity, or harsh environments. Rigid flex pcb supplier option need to be based on demonstrated experience with material handling, lamination, drilling, and assembly of blended rigid and flex structures.
